Week 12 - Personal Skills for Effective Business Analysis

The effective use of analytics tools and techniques is a key requirement when analyzing the business problems your organization is currently dealing with. However, it’s vital that you also possess a strong set of personal skills to help you process and understand the large amounts of data you’ll likely come across during your analysis. In this course, you'll learn about some of the personal competencies required by a business analyst. These skills are covered in the business analysis body of knowledge (BABOK), and include analytical thinking and problem solving, interaction skills, and communication skills. Outcome: Build personal competencies such as analytical thinking, communication, and problem-solving skills. Participants will learn how to effectively interpret data, engage stakeholders, and foster productive collaboration.
